About OT Jobs in Grand Rapids, MI

Grand Rapids Ot Jobs Overview

Everyone working in occupational therapy (OT) is a healthcare luminary—inspiring hope and fostering recovery, as they harness the therapeutic use of everyday activities to help people with various conditions. OT jobs may involve anything from injury rehabilitation and home modifications for greater mobility to auxiliary treatments for cerebral palsy (e.g., improving posture and muscle-coordination issues) and arthritis (e.g., joint-stretching).

All around, the OT field is growing.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), the employment of occupational therapists is expected to swell at a rate of 17 percent over the next decade, which roughly translates to 10,100 job openings each year during this period. Additionally, positions for occupational therapy assistants and aides are predicted to bloom at a sweeping 34 percent. Both of those percentages are much faster than the average for the full breadth of jobs in all industries.

About Working in Grand Rapids, Michigan

Situated near the eastern side of Lake Michigan, Grand Rapids goes by many different nicknames, including "Furniture City," "River City," and "Beer City" for having more craft beer per square mile than anywhere else in the world. Grand Rapids also has tons of attractions to offer, including John Ball Zoo, the Urban Institute for Contemporary Arts, and Frederik Meijer Gardens and Sculpture Park. It shouldn't come as a surprise that Livability ranked Grand Rapids among the top 100 best places to live in the U.S. Want to be a part of River City? How Much Do Ot Jobs Pay in Grand Rapids, Michigan?

Got money on your mind? You should! Make sure you’re getting paid what you’re worth. Our Salary Tools can help you understand what you can expect to make in OT jobs in Grand Rapids, Michigan, as well as the skills that can boost your value and what the next steps in your career might be. Right now, the median occupational therapist pay in Grand Rapids is $30.85 per hour, which is 24% lower than the national average.
